Reserves 2-0 Stevenage Wed 24th Jan 2007 21:21
Woodbridge Town striker Joe Francis did his hopes of winning a Town contract no harm with a goal and a fine performance as the Blues second string defeated Stevenage Borough 2-0 at Portman Road. Jordan Rhodes scored the other goal in a game that Town should have won more convincingly.

Sunderland 1-0 Town Sat 13th Jan 2007 23:14
David Connolly's 13th minute goal was enough to give Sunderland a 1-0 victory over the Blues at the Stadium of Light. Despite enjoying a lot of possession, particularly in the second half, Town were unable to get back on terms, the best chance falling to sub Danny Haynes.
Reserves Defeat Dons Tue 09th Jan 2007 21:19
Town's reserves defeated the MK Dons 2-1 in their first game of 2007 at Portman Road. The Blues went ahead through Danny Haynes in the first half before Oliver Thorne equalised for the visitors, but Jaime Peters sealed the win after the break.
Chester 0-0 Town Sat 06th Jan 2007 23:00
Town face an FA Cup replay at Portman Road a week on Tuesday after drawing 0-0 with Chester at the Deva Stadium. The Blues were lucky not to be behind before a late fight back saw Alan Lee hit the bar.
Town 1-0 Birmingham Mon 01st Jan 2007 18:38
Gavin Williams struck in the 89th minute to give the Blues a deserved 1-0 victory over Birmingham City. The second half sub volleyed home Gary Roberts's cross after Town had had the ball repeatedly cleared off the Birmingham line, had a penalty call turned down and had hit the woodwork.
Town 1-1 Burnley Sat 02nd Dec 2006 18:43
An injury time penalty from Alan Lee against one of his old clubs salvaged a point for the Blues against Burnley. Profligate Town should have had the game sewn up before Kyle Lafferty's goal four minutes from time but after Gifton Noel-Williams's handball, Lee saved the Blues from another defeat.

Garvan to Start at Derby Tue 28th Nov 2006 12:29
Boss Jim Magilton has confirmed that Owen Garvan will make his first start of the season at Derby County on Wednesday, while Billy Clarke and Fabian Wilnis are both injury concerns. Garvan will replace Sylvain Legwinski, who is suspended after reaching five bookings.
Robson on Roberts Mon 20th Nov 2006 18:16
Loanee winger Gary Roberts was the man who most impressed the watching Sir Bobby Robson during the Blues' 3-1 derby victory over Norwich City on Sunday. The club president was back at Portman Road for the first time since his recent cancer operation.
